When should Vietnam traders trade?
Vietnam traders (UTC+7) have excellent access to Asian market sessions. Sydney opens at 5:00 AM local time, followed by Tokyo at 7:00 AM, creating prime opportunities for AUD/JPY, USD/JPY, and Nikkei trading during normal morning hours. The London session begins at 2:00 PM (winter) or 1:00 PM (summer), overlapping with afternoon hours for EUR/USD, GBP/USD activity. New York opens at 9:00 PM local time, making it challenging for same-day management. The Tokyo-London overlap (2:00-4:00 PM local) provides the highest volatility window for major pairs. Overnight positions work well given the timezone advantage for catching European morning moves while sleeping.
How do Vietnam traders pay for E8 Markets?
Vietnam traders using E8 Markets typically face USD conversion requirements as direct VND payments aren't accepted. Wise (formerly TransferWise) offers competitive rates and fast processing for international transfers. Skrill and Neteller work reliably for both deposits and withdrawals, with faster processing than traditional bank wires. Credit/debit cards function well for challenge fees but may face restrictions for profit withdrawals due to Vietnamese banking regulations. Cryptocurrency payments provide an alternative but aren't universally supported across all E8 services. Local bank transfers require USD accounts or conversion through Vietnamese banks, adding 1-3 business days to processing times.
